Re: Potential S4 Avant owner

Post by Dippy » Fri Nov 14, 2003 1:19 pm

APR bipipe solves the TBB problem nicely.

But expensively. I've not damaged a TBB (yet)...

Not that expensive compared to the cost of turbo replacement [img]images/graemlins/laugh.gif[/img]

Also in theory because it doesn't flex like the TBB and has enlarged DV ports, throttle response should theoretically be improved. [img]images/graemlins/boots.gif[/img]
